What makes pistachio shells different
The pistachio shell is denser and more carbon-rich than most biomass feedstocks used in charcoal production. That density translates directly into combustion behavior: pistachio shell cubes hold their heat at a steady plateau rather than spiking and dropping the way many coconut or wood briquettes do. Ash output sits in the 8 to 12 percent range, well below the 15 to 25 percent typical of wood-based alternatives and noticeably lower than the 12 to 18 percent common in coconut charcoal.
For hookah lounge operators, lower ash means less frequent coal changes during a session, improving throughput and reducing table-side interruptions. For end consumers, it means a cleaner bowl and a flavor profile that stays true from the first draw to the last.
From raw shell to finished cube
At Rawafed, the production process starts with carefully sourced pistachio shells from established suppliers across the Middle East. The shells pass through a multi-stage preparation sequence: cleaning to remove dust and organic debris, controlled drying to bring moisture below the 8 percent threshold, and fine grinding into a uniform powder. That powder then enters hydraulic presses operating at pressures exceeding 200 bar, producing a briquette with consistent geometry and density throughout.

Every production batch undergoes testing across four parameters: heat output consistency, ash content percentage, structural integrity under handling and transport, and total burn duration. Cubes that fall outside specification are rejected before packaging. The result is a burn duration of 60 to 90 minutes per cube, depending on size and airflow conditions.
The sustainability case
Pistachio shells are a genuine waste stream. The global pistachio industry generates hundreds of thousands of tons of shells annually, the vast majority ending up in landfills or burned without energy recovery. Converting them into precision-manufactured charcoal cubes creates economic value from material that would otherwise represent a disposal cost. This is not a marginal environmental benefit; it is a fundamental shift in how an agricultural byproduct is utilized.

That sustainability profile carries real commercial weight in export markets where regulatory pressure and consumer preference are both moving toward products with lower environmental footprints. Distributors serving the European, Turkish, and Gulf markets increasingly treat raw material sourcing as a procurement criterion rather than a marketing talking point.
